**Release checklist — Veldrome build fleet.** Before signing the release, verify clock skew across all build agents is under 200ms. Skewed clocks on the Hollowmark agents have previously produced artifacts with timestamps earlier than their source commits, which breaks provenance verification downstream. Run the skew probe from the coordinator node, record the maximum drift, and attach the report to the release ticket. The probe prints the token to include right below this item.

pipeline stamp: htk31_f769b577b3028a4e9958e5bb8d1259a

- [ ] **Step 7: Breaker override escrow.** After sealing the signing keys for the Tallgrove upstream API circuit breaker, confirm the support team can force the breaker open during a full outage. The override bundle lives in the sealed escrow drawer and is useless without its unlock phrase. Two ceremony witnesses must initial this step before proceeding. The escrow bundle is decrypted with the recovery passphrase that follows.

vault phrase of kahip-kahop = holath-quenmir

Action Item 12: Close the tracing gaps between the Orvane checkout and fulfillment microservices before the next release cut. Missing span propagation in the message-bus consumers meant we could not reconstruct the failed order path during the incident, which added roughly two hours to diagnosis. We will upgrade all consumers to the shared tracing middleware and add a CI check that fails builds lacking context propagation. For the release manager: rollout status and per-service readiness are tracked on the internal page below.

runbook for badug-kadup: https://confluence.zemvarlabs.internal/projects/browse/display/projects/bd1b